FrogmetricsSummer 2008

Frogmetrics aggregates your data from unlimited locations, automatically finds the most important statistics, and helps you gain insights about your business from your web browser. The company wants to place touch screens in restaurants, stores, and other brick and mortar establishments that can be used to collect customer feedback on the spot. The devices ask customers a few questions at the point of sale about their experience and can collect contact information about customers to generate leads. The information gathered across physical locations is aggregated and analyzed for trends and other statistics.

OurMenuWinter 2018

OurMenu provides an online food ordering service. The company replaces ordering from a waiter with ordering from a website.\n\nOurMenu wants to let its users to order from phone instead of talking to a waiter, without downloading an app. Users can scan a QR code on the table, choose their food, order and pay, and then the food is brought tothem. OurMenu plans to charge restaurants $300 per month for the tech, and will aggregate the menu choice data to sell back to them.

WundrbarWinter 2008

Wundrbar wants to improve upon the search bar experience by providing users with powerful inline commands. The idea is reminiscent of YubNub but Wundrbar strives to appeal to a larger audience and to incorporate functionality that helps people manage their personal online accounts in addition to searching the web.
